JOB SUMMARY:

The Process Engineer will provide technical process engineering support across assigned projects, supporting the development, analysis, and execution of process systems. Positions are available at multiple levels, ranging from intermediate design engineers to senior and principal-level leads.

Depending on experience, individuals may perform engineering design work, support complex process calculations, or provide leadership and oversight for process engineering scope, ensuring technical accuracy and alignment with project requirements.

DUTIES / RESPONSIBILITIES:

Develop and review process design criteria, calculations, and specifications
Prepare and review Piping & Instrumentation Diagrams (P&IDs) and related engineering documents
Perform process calculations, simulations, and system analyses
Support development of:
Heat and material balances
Process flow diagrams (PFDs)
Equipment lists and process datasheets
Utility summaries and system design inputs
Participate in or support Hazard Analyses (HazOp / PHA)
Coordinate technical issues with multi-disciplinary teams (mechanical, electrical, project management, etc.)
Provide technical support for:
Procurement activities (bid evaluations, vendor submittals)
Construction (RFIs, field changes, commissioning support)
Ensure work is executed in accordance with:
Project scope, cost, and schedule baselines
Applicable procedures, codes, and standards
Additional for Senior / Principal Levels:

Lead process engineering scope for assigned areas or projects
Provide technical guidance and oversight to engineers and designers
Develop project estimates, schedules, and progress reports
Interface with clients, vendors, and stakeholders on technical matters
